Disillusioned Milei Supporters Seek Center Ground Amidst Growing Political Discontent

Africa1 hr ago

A segment of former supporters of Argentine President Javier Milei is reportedly shifting towards the political center, seeking a less polarized option. This group feels disillusioned with the current political climate and the direction of the country under Milei's administration. Notably, neither the Peronist movement nor other established political forces appear to be effectively capturing this growing dissatisfaction. These individuals are seeking representation that reflects a more moderate stance, which they currently find lacking in the political landscape. Their departure represents a challenge for Milei's government, as it indicates a potential erosion of his base. The reasons for this shift are complex, stemming from economic concerns, ideological disagreements, and a general weariness with intense political polarization. The government faces the challenge of understanding these evolving sentiments and potentially recalibrating its approach to regain the trust of this segment of the electorate. The current political vacuum in the center leaves these voters adrift, highlighting a significant opportunity for new political formations or a strategic shift by existing parties.
